Undergrad Institution: Liberal Arts, great rep in biology
Major(s): Biology
Minor(s): Chemistry
GPA in Major: 3.5
Overall GPA: 3.43
Position in Class: No idea
Type of Student: Domestic, lady

GRE Scores (revised/old version):
Q: 155 (60%)
V: 158 (79%)
W: 4.5 (80%)


Research Experience: 
2 undergraduate independent studies (1 microbiology/1 epigenetics and neuroscience)

1 summer research assistant (at a 10 top university, studying apoptosis and regeneration)

Current research technician at R01 University (studying parasitology and genetics, ~1.25 years)

Awards/Honors/Recognitions: College and Departmental Honors

Pertinent Activities or Jobs: 

Tutor/TA for 3 years (general chemistry, cell biology, genetics)

Research assistant

Research Technician

Any Miscellaneous Accomplishments that Might Help: Posters and oral presentations at local, regional, and national conferences.

Special Bonus Points: LGBTQ/lady

Applying to Where:
University of Arizona-Entomology

University of Arizona-ABBS

UC Berkeley-MCB

UC Davis-Microbiology

Johns Hopkins-Pathobiology

Johns Hopkins-Molecular Biology

University of Illinois, Urbana-EEB

University of Nevada-Reno-EEB/MB

UMass Amherst-Microbiology

I got like almost all of my 6 interview invites the week of December 15-21 (?) last year, and some even on the same day. UAB was about a week later I think, but still definitely before the end of December. Great username, by the way :)

Edit because I forgot part of your question: Absolutely, email and ask - it shows interest in the program and that you're taking initiative to be able to go to interview weekends. I absolutely did.
